Core Challenge: Why Toxic Scores Cause Unnecessary Panic
Core Challenge: Why Toxic Scores Cause Unnecessary Panic
A high toxic score can trigger panic—but it shouldn’t. The metric, often generated by tools like Semrush, is a risk signal, not a penalty. According to Google’s own guidance, only backlinks that violate spam policies—like paid link schemes—are truly harmful. Most spammy links are ignored by Google’s algorithm, meaning a high score doesn’t equate to a ranking drop.
Yet, many small business owners react with fear, even disavowing links they didn’t create. This overreaction can backfire—Gary Illyes (Google Webmaster Trends Analyst) warns that broad disavowals may harm visibility more than the links ever did.
- Toxicity Score (0–100): Scores above 20–30 merit review, but not automatic action.
- Google’s stance: Most spammy links are ignored—no penalty, no need to disavow.
- Disavowal risk: Can take weeks to process, with recovery taking up to 45 days.
- Context is key: A link from a gambling site may be risky for a school but acceptable for a casino reviewer.
The real danger isn’t the score—it’s the reaction.
Instead of panic, focus on proactive SEO hygiene. Regular audits using tools like Semrush’s Backlink Audit Tool help identify high-risk links—but only act if you know you engaged in manipulative practices.
